MONTEREY PARK, CA – East Los Angeles College Foundation proudly announces a groundbreaking milestone with its record-breaking scholarship event, showcasing an extraordinary commitment to education and empowering the next generation of leaders. The event, held on May 20, 2024, shattered the previous year's record amount of $199.867, underscoring the organization's dedication to providing transformative educational opportunities. East Los Angeles College (ELAC) awarded 225 scholars, with a total of $216,600 in scholarships for Spring 2024, with four brand new scholarships, making this the most awarded scholarships in the history of ELAC.

CPL. Guy Gabaldon VFW Post 1013 Memorial Scholarship
Named after ELAC Alumni, World War II hero, and Silver Star recipient CPL. Guy Gabaldon, the scholarship is designed to support a current full- or part-time ELAC veteran student who has completed at least 12 units or more and has a cumulative GPA of 2.75 or better for all coursework. The recipient must be a US Veteran and a member of the ELAC Veterans Club.

About East Los Angeles College: ELAC is the largest of nine two-year community colleges within the Los Angeles Community College District (LACCD) and has the largest student headcount of any Community College in California.
